general requirements

To rent a car in Pakistan, you will need an International Driver’s License, also known as an International Driving Permit (IDP), if you are a foreigner. You can obtain this license through your country’s licensing authorities prior to departure.

The legal minimum driving age in Pakistan is 18 and this applies to foreign nationals driving a rental car within the country. At the same time, many car rental companies across the country have a young driver requirement that requires drivers under the age of 25 to pay higher charges commensurate with the risk they pose. When approaching a service provider, you should check whether such charges apply.

Where to find rentals

Car rental companies operate in all major cities including Islamabad, Karachi and Lahore. They usually have offices at international airports and in larger hotels, popular with foreign businessmen and tourists. While you can rent a car directly from said office, you may want to do so online prior to your arrival. This will ensure that you will be able to use a car that fully meets your needs during your stay. All major car rental services have a website that supports online reservations.

What types of cars can be rented in Pakistan? When you use a trusted service with a solid reputation, you can expect all vehicles to be less than 10 years old. You can choose from sedans, coupes, SUVs, and even trucks in some cases. There are also luxury vehicles. It is worth noting that the cars are mostly from Asian and European brands such as Honda, Toyota, Suzuki and Mercedes Benz and BMW.

Costs and Payments

The price you will pay to rent a car in Pakistan depends on the type of vehicle you rent and the length of the rental. There are additional charges for special services, such as the delivery of the car directly to the place where you will stay. The cost of insurance is also added to the total price. Before traveling to the country, you should verify if your auto insurance at home extends or can be extended to this country. You can also ask if your international credit card comes with auto insurance coverage valid in the country.

Check when and how you are expected to pay when you rent a car in Pakistan. Most companies require a deposit and some will only accept a cash deposit in the local currency, the Pakistani rupee. Ideally, you will be able to pay both the deposit and the rest of the total cost through a credit card.
